Sr. Security Incident Response Engineer

Autodesk Autodesk · Enterprise · Bangalore, India +1

This role focuses on security incident response using Splunk for monitoring, analysis, and investigation of security incidents across various data sources in cloud-agnostic environments. It involves documentation, collaboration, and staying updated on cybersecurity trends.

What you'd actually do

  1. Actively monitor security dashboards and alerts using Splunk to detect suspicious activities and potential incidents.
  2. Perform in-depth analyses of security events, leveraging Splunk to aggregate and correlate data from various telemetry sources to identify IOCs.
  3. Assist in coordinated incident response efforts during high-stakes investigations.
  4. Maintain clear, detailed incident reports and contribute to the creation and refinement of technical playbooks and standard operating procedures.
  5. Stay abreast of industry trends, emerging threat techniques, and best practices in incident response and cybersecurity.

Skills

Required

  • 3-5 years of experience in security operations or incident response
  • Proficiency in conducting investigations
  • Strong command of Splunk for log analysis, data correlation, and building dashboards
  • Solid understanding of incident response processes
  • Familiarity with telemetry, SIEM/SOAR integration
  • Experience with cloud environments (Azure, AWS, GCP)
